Agatha Greenway is a graduate student in the Sowers Laboratory at the University of Iowa, Iowa City, Iowa. She graduated with first-class honors with a Bachelor's degree in Natural Sciences from the University of Bath, England. Her undergraduate career included a year as a research scholar investigating the role of the posterior thalamus in migraine in the Russo Laboratory at the University of Iowa. Agatha returned to the University of Iowa for her PhD and is currently in the third year of her studies. Her thesis focuses on the role of a cerebellar-cingulate circuit in migraine symptoms, using mouse behavioral models.
